The client, a private winemaker in Jamestown, Rhode Island, asked that the design for his first set of labels reflect both his midcentury modern taste and an artisanal, handmade feel. To solve the design problem with minimal waste, we created a clean, two-color design with letterpress printing. The labels were printed by hand at an Atlanta letterpress studio with Gans Soy Plus ink, made with soy and nut oil, which contains less than 1 percent VOC. The 100 percent cotton paper label was applied to the bottles with nontoxic adhesive.
